Output 643728e56c20b9e1b54fe5293b79888f53e01e8c05aeffebf9085f3cd15c1053:49

value
57278066
script pubkey
OP_0 OP_PUSHBYTES_20 4ee57a1f020a32b3bb82bbc95fef1ec63e13512b
address
bc1qfmjh58czpget8wuzh0y4lmc7cclpx5fthesrvt
transaction
643728e56c20b9e1b54fe5293b79888f53e01e8c05aeffebf9085f3cd15c1053
confirmations
33103
spent
true